Outline:
In this course, the student will acquire knowledge of the present situation of the Japanese construction industry, construction production, the temporary construction methods and construction works related to architectural structures, and the management methods focusing on quality. The instructors (Taniguchi and Nakagawa) have experience in design supervision at construction sites of famous companies, and through the lectures and exercises will transmit to the students their knowledge.

Introduction (1): Characteristics of building construction and the role of bidding, contract, client, designer, construction supplier and manager. Present situation and prevision of the future of building construction business. |
To understand the steps of architectural production, and the role of bidding, contract, client, designer, contractor, and manager. To understand construction related laws and regulations.

Earthwork and Earth retaining work (1) Excavation, backfill, drainage method, stabilization of excavation bottom and the earth property (N value and earth pressure). |
To understand excavation, backfill, drainage method, stabilization of excavation bottom and the earth property (N value and earth pressure).

Reinforcement concrete structural work (1) RC structure and construction planning characteristics and materials, construction management important points. Outline of RC work, anchor for the main bar, hook, bar spacing and covering depth. |
To understand RC structure and construction planning characteristics and materials, construction management important points, RC work, anchor for the main bar, hook, bar spacing and covering depth.

Reinforcement concrete structural work (2) The principle of gas pressure welding, UT method, and construction management important points. Outline of concrete formwork and the pressure of concrete subjected to the form. |
To understand the principle of gas pressure welding, UT method, and construction management important points, concrete formwork and the pressure of concrete subjected to the form.
